Background:
- The Compass Elbow Hinge, based on Ilizarov's principles, was designed for elbow contractures.
- Previous studies focused on adult applications for ankylosis and instability.
Purpose of the Study:
- To evaluate the efficacy and safety of the Compass Elbow Hinge in pediatric patients.
- To assess outcomes for post-traumatic elbow stiffness and post-septic arthritis ankylosis.
Main Methods:
- Five pediatric patients (12-15 years) with elbow issues were treated.
- The Compass Elbow Hinge was used with open soft tissue release.
- Postoperative mobilization and physiotherapy were initiated immediately.
Main Results:
- Improved range of motion was observed in three out of five patients.
- Complications included pin track infections (3 patients) and transient ulnar neuropraxia (1 patient).
- Follow-up ranged from 5 to 36 months.
Conclusions:
- The Compass Elbow Hinge shows potential for treating pediatric elbow contractures and stiffness.
- Surgical release and early mobilization are crucial components of treatment.
- Further research is warranted to optimize outcomes in pediatric populations.
